It’s like having somebody stay within the building to make sure it is comfortable and meets their needs. UAT is essential as it gauges how the software program will carry out in its meant setting and whether it meets person expectations. This helps product heads identify and create experiments to access totally different classes of consumer information (click percentages, navigation, and habits cohorts) for his or her products. The group additionally reviewed heatmaps for both desktop and cellular units. The heatmaps for cellular customers showed that folks didn’t scroll far enough down the web page to see their CTA.
The preliminary part in software program testing, pre-testing preparation, sets the stage for a successful and efficient testing process. Studying successful person testing examples helps you understand totally different use instances for consumer testing methods whereas setting expectations for results. To fix these points, the staff added a search bar to the integrations’ listing and included pop-ups, videos, and several sorts of content material to information the consumer step-by-step by way of onboarding.
What Are The Completely Different Type Of Guidelines Based Testing?
The under talked about checklist is almost relevant for all types of web functions depending on the business necessities. Pronounced “San Francisco Depot,” the mnemonic stands for structure, operate, data, interfaces, platform, operations, and time. One attainable train for check planning is to list these as nodes, then create sub-notes for the risks associated to those parts of the software. Once full, evaluate that record of risks with the check plan up to now to ensure these dangers are coated.
Recordings from the A/B check showed that users had stopped rage-clicking and have been actively interacting with the FAQs earlier than proceeding to donations. Dave then A/B tested the new flow in opposition to the previous one to see the influence of the redesign. By implementing the modifications heatmaps and A/B tests highlighted, the team increased sign-ups by 25%. Security Testing includes the test to establish any flaws and gaps from a security point of view. A Usability check establishes the ease of use and effectiveness of a product utilizing a normal Usability take a look at practices.
This helps to put the testing process in context and make certain that somebody is liable for it. Its major objective is to ensure that latest adjustments or additions to the software program haven’t adversely affected the present functionalities. Even small modifications can typically have surprising repercussions, so by frequently working regression tests, you’ll have the ability to guarantee continuous high quality. GAT also conducts useful bug reports, usability and UX assessments, and test case pass/fail evaluations, providing detailed insights for software program improvements. Additionally, our approach integrates safety and compliance checks to ensure software safety and adherence to rules. Doodle also used Hotjar Surveys to ask open-ended questions about their options and the overall consumer expertise, so they may perceive what their prospects truly beloved about the device.
It’s also important to know when and where it’s greatest to make use of checklist-based testing, though the identical may be said about every kind of software program testing. Test documentation’s role in the testing course of can be enhanced with using testing checklists. It promotes effective progress monitoring and assessing how nicely the testing is performing. A take a look at plan doc is a document of the test planning course of that describes the scope, approach, resources, and schedule of supposed take a look at actions. A complete test plan is the cornerstone of successful software program testing, serving as a strategic docume… In this chapter of our Usability Testing information, we’ve assembled twelve helpful templates, checklists, and scripts you can begin from to make your usability testing plan as efficient as possible.
Once the guidelines is reviewed, it may be handed over to the testing team so that they will carry out the testing activities based mostly on it. The testing team must have the power to analyze the checklist to figure out the priority order to be adopted whereas testing. The important functionalities should be prioritized first, adopted by the less crucial ones. Additionally, checklist-based testing serves as a sturdy mechanism for reducing human error in testing. Testers have a transparent set of predefined steps and standards to follow, minimizing the danger of oversight or inaccuracies in the testing process. The checklist ought to have the name of the project, the name of the tester, and the date the state of affairs was run.
This results in better quality and extra environment friendly testing processes over time. Checklist-based testing is among the most generally used software testing approaches in recent checklist based testing times. It supplies a structured method of testing by utilizing the predefined checklist created before the precise testing is finished.
Unit Testing – Examining The Smallest Components
The testing requirements involve the testing instruments, check surroundings, test data, test instances, test scenarios, areas to be tested, preconditions, and the expected outcomes. Explore the facility of checklist-based testing for software program, websites, and games. Boost effectivity, guarantee thorough coverage, and deliver reliable products with structured testing approaches. Effective communication and collaboration throughout the testing staff are also facilitated by way of the use of checklists. They present a common reference level for testers, making it simpler to speak findings and issues with readability. Developers can use the checklist as a guide when addressing reported points, resulting in environment friendly concern resolution.
It means every enterprise has to maintain a net site to gain the traction of the viewers and provide them with adequate data to make a purchase order decision. Nielsen Norman Group is a leading UX research and consulting agency, widely considered a pacesetter in the world of consumer expertise. They offer e-courses, in-person training, and events on UX research, in addition to a really useful blog. Welcome to Testmetry, a vibrant platform designed to attach professionals and foster information sharing. My weblog is an open area where I aim to engage with fellow experts, exchanging experiences, insights, and expertise. Through Testmetry, I aspire to create a community where professionals from numerous fields can come together, learn from one another, and grow collectively.
Breaking Atomic Design System In Ui
These are the situations or requirements that have to be met before the scenario could be run. For instance, certain software program should be installed or sure steps have to be taken earlier than the state of affairs may be run. Software is everywhere round us, and it’s important for your testing group to be acquainted with all the various varieties and platforms software program can come with. In 21+ years, our QA team has examined each type of software there may be, and listed right here are a few of their specialties. It’s also possible to broaden this checklist to a low-level one, relying on the requirements and the available resources. For example, we are ready to take the Homepage part and create the following checklist based mostly on this factor, adding supplementary elements, similar to Additional data, to it if necessary.
They additionally redesigned buttons, making them bolder and extra visible on small screens. Acting on the insights from consumer testing by making it simpler for folks to attach calendars and specializing in in style options, Doodle elevated conversions by 300%. Doodle, a gathering scheduling device, was affected by inconclusive and sometimes misleading in-tool information, which frustrated the team as a result of they didn’t know how to optimize the product to extend adoption. So they decided to conduct user tests and see what their device was missing. Analyzing successful person testing examples helps you answer all these questions. We aimed to make a guidelines that hits the candy spot of good enough, enough of the time, for sufficient folks as a result of a comprehensive listing would be overwhelming.
QA (Quality Assurance) engineers use such checklists to information the testing actions. In this weblog publish, we are going to talk about on what’s checklist based testing and the numerous advantages of guidelines based testing. The QA engineer’s experience with a selected software program product is extra necessary than their experience with software testing in general. Because of that, an important requirement for a profitable end result of checklist-based testing is the engineer’s familiarity with the product’s specifications and necessities.
Learning From Testing – Gaining Insights For Enchancment
UXPin is a digital collaborative design platform that helps users design, build, and take a look at prototypes for websites. Their web site has many free e-books and webinars about web design, consumer experience, and product development, and their templates are created primarily based on tons of of hours of user testing. While analyzing the performance of the product that’s about to be tested, the engineers either create a new testing guidelines or increase an present one. Below, you will notice how you ought to use testing checklists depending on where you are in your software testing course of.
- Establishing an acceptable testing environment is the next important step.
- Find out in case your software program resolution supplies an enticing user experience.
- Together, these elements can make a poor impression of an internet site and reduce its capability.
- Outsource your testing needs to a team of specialists with relevant abilities.
- This is why a QA engineer ought to start by getting ready all the available take a look at standards if they want to take benefit of this technique.
- The under talked about guidelines is sort of applicable for each type of net applications depending on the business necessities.
Checklist based testing is a software program testing method that includes creating a listing of specific steps or tasks to be carried out in testing a particular system or utility. The tester makes use of the checklist as a guide for conducting the exams, following each step systematically and documenting the outcomes. The major aim of checklist-based testing is to provide a structured approach to testing and to ensure that important steps usually are not missed.
Modern users count on a web page load inside two seconds, even if they’re one of many hundreds of individuals utilizing the software program. It is tough to assume of this as “nonfunctional” testing if the software doesn’t function underneath load. This consists of activities around creating a function and just before a launch, which could be anything from “shakedown” testing to a detailed regression of the complete system. One way to look at a test plan is as a collection of risks work managing. This guidelines provides ideas for what these dangers may be and how to deal with them, together with what to name out of scope. But if you’re new to usability testing, you don’t need to go all in and use the templates above.
Throughout the method, you’re conscious of the required assets, subsequent steps, and accountability. Designers and builders can use it to develop a typical project timeline and deliver tasks on schedule. To perform complete internet software testing, it’s necessary to do several types of checks that fulfill the requirements mentioned in the net app testing guidelines above. Checklist-based testing is a kind of software testing primarily based on the pre-planned “to-do” list of duties known as a checklist. Professional testers, who’ve sufficient technical experience usually full these lists.
It focuses on particular person elements or items of code to make sure that each half capabilities as supposed. By testing these smallest elements of the software, you possibly can catch and fix errors early, simplifying later testing phases. Global App Testing (GAT) emphasizes replicating real-world environments to ensure complete software testing. We give consideration to superior targeting for a diverse and inclusive person representation, testing across various units, connectivity environments, and world locations.
To preserve the integrity of your usability testing results, take a purposeful and methodical approach to testing. Using a few of these checklists and templates offers you a head start towards an organized and efficient usability study. Hotjar (see level 5) has more instruments for conducting remote usability testing, in addition to structured consumer interviews. We’ve put together a customizable script for working a remote usability take a look at based on screen sharing through Hotjar Engage or the video conferencing app Zoom. Hotjar is a user feedback and conduct analytics platform that helps people higher perceive the web habits and opinions of their web site users.
Grow your business, transform and implement technologies based on artificial intelligence. https://www.globalcloudteam.com/ has a staff of experienced AI engineers.